Therefore, there are some things you should look out for when getting steaks, such as their thickness, and marbling; which are the white lines that run through each cut of your meat and also choosing the actual part of the meat.

#5 A5 Kobe Filet
Price: $295
The Tajima Cattle is needed to make the A5 Kobe Filet, one of the most expensive steaks in the world. The Tajima Cattle reared in a natural and clean environment with quality food and water is regarded as the peak of Japanese wagyu.
